#
cp.apple.finalcutpro.viewer.Viewer
Viewer Module.
#
API Overview
Constants - Useful values which cannot be changed
BACKGROUND PLAYBACK_MODE
Functions - API calls offered directly by the extension
matches
Constructors - API calls which return an object, typically one that offers API methods
Viewer
Fields - Variables which can only be accessed from an object returned by a constructor
background betterQuality contentsUI controlBar frame framerate getFormat hasPlayerControls infoBar isEventViewer isMainViewer isOnPrimary isOnSecondary playbackMode playButton timecode timecodeField title usingProxies videoImage videoImageUI
Methods - API calls which can only be made on an object returned by a constructor
app currentWindow doHide doPause doPlay doShowOnPrimary doShowOnSecondary hide notifier showOnPrimary showOnSecondary
#
API Documentation
#
Constants
#
BACKGROUND
#
PLAYBACK_MODE
#
Functions
#
matches
#
Constructors
#
Viewer
#
Fields
#
background
#
betterQuality
| | |
| --------------------------------------------|-------------------------------------------------------------------------------------|
| Signature | cp.apple.finalcutpro.viewer.Viewer.betterQuality <cp.prop: boolean, read-only> |
| Type | Field |
| Description | Checks if the viewer is using playing with better quality (true) or performance (false). | | **Notes** | <ul><li>Use playbackMode` to change modes between original/proxy/quality/performance. |
| Source | src/extensions/cp/apple/finalcutpro/viewer/Viewer.lua line 457 |
#
contentsUI
#
controlBar
#
frame
#
framerate
#
getFormat
#
hasPlayerControls
#
infoBar
#
isEventViewer
#
isMainViewer
#
isOnPrimary
#
isOnSecondary
#
playbackMode
#
playButton
#
timecode
#
timecodeField
#
title
#
usingProxies
#
videoImage
#
videoImageUI
#
Methods
#
app
#
currentWindow
#
doHide
#
doPause
#
doPlay
#
doShowOnPrimary
#
doShowOnSecondary
#
hide
#
notifier
#
showOnPrimary
#
showOnSecondary
See also
Module
Represents the Final Cut Pro application, providing functions that allow different tasks to be accomplished.
Extends Role
Represents the bottom "control" bar on a Viewer which contains the play/pause button, timecode, audio meters, etc.
Represents the bar of information about the Viewer (format, title, viewing options).